Character of the water

Stora Patan lies in central Sweden — a nutrient-rich lowland lake. In summer a thermocline settles around 5 m and splits the lake into two worlds.

The surroundings

The lake sits close to town with a road right up to it — easy to reach, but hard-fished and exposed to nutrient runoff from the buildings and fields all around.

Moderately deep (9 m) — shallow bays, the odd reef and a deeper channel through the middle.

Permits & rules

Fishing permit required — Stora Patan FVOF. Day permit ~100 kr · annual permit ~500 kr.

  • Zander: minimum size 45 cm · protected during the spawn (Apr–May).
  • Pike: keep at most one over 75 cm per day.
  • Handheld tackle only. Respect the protected zones at the inlets and outlets.

Fishing Stora Patan

Stora Patan holds 5 species, with perch, pike and zander at the top of the chain and roach and bream schooling beneath them. The modest depth keeps most of the fishing within reach of the bank.
